Jennifer Garner Versace dress 13 Going on 30

 Jennifer Garner, the actress who played aspiring magazine editor Jenna Rink in the 2004 rom-com "13 Going on 30," recently revealed that she wishes she had kept the now-iconic multicolored Versace dress she wore in the movie.


Garner, 51, opened up about the frock during the Wednesday, November 29, episode of The View, explaining that the design "ended up in a warehouse with other clothes from the movie" after filming wrapped ¹.



"Well, first of all, you're not supposed to keep your clothes," she shared. "I'm a good two-shoes so I [didn't]. Also, who had any idea that that movie was gonna be more than just something that came and went?" Garner added ¹.


Garner was later surprised to see the dress make a cameo in an episode of Sex and the City, which premiered in 2003, a year before "13 Going on 30" hit theaters. The dress was spotted on an extra as Carrie Bradshaw (Sarah Jessica Parker) and pal Stanford Blatch (Willie Garson) watched Smith's play. "It ended up in the background — it was just put on background players in Sex and the City," Garner said on The View. "Yeah, there it is!" ¹.
